The Mysterious World of BTUs

BTU stands for British Thermal Unit. Don’t let the "British" part fool you; it’s a universally understood measurement. Think of it as a unit of energy, the amount needed to raise the temperature of one pound of water by one degree Fahrenheit.

So, when we talk about an air conditioner having, say, 10,000 BTUs, we're talking about its cooling capacity. It's how much heat it can remove from a room in an hour.

Why Knowing Your BTUs Matters (More Than You Think!)

Picking the right BTU for your space is crucial. Go too small, and your AC will struggle, working overtime like a marathon runner in flip-flops. You'll end up with a sweaty situation and a hefty electricity bill.

Too big, and your AC will cycle on and off too frequently. This leads to uneven cooling, a damp feeling, and – surprise! – a higher electricity bill. It's like hiring a marching band to play "Twinkle Twinkle Little Star"; overkill doesn't equal comfort.

The "Room Size" Rule of Thumb

The easiest way to get a ballpark BTU figure is by considering the size of the room. A general rule is to multiply the square footage of the room by 25.

So, if you have a 200-square-foot bedroom, you'd need roughly 5,000 BTUs (200 x 25 = 5,000). Simple, right? Almost... because life, like central air repair, has a few more wrinkles.

Adding Heat to the Equation (Literally!)

Rooms with lots of sunlight need more BTUs. Sunlight is like a tiny army of heat soldiers invading your space. So, if your room is basking in sunshine all day, add about 10% to your BTU calculation.

Is your kitchen connected to the room? Add another 4,000 BTUs. Stoves and ovens love to radiate heat like they're competing for an Olympic medal.

Each person regularly occupying the room adds about 600 BTUs. People are little heat generators, especially after that third slice of pizza.

The Appliance Effect: Not Just for Kitchens

Think about the other heat-producing appliances in the room. Computers, TVs, and even lamps can contribute to the overall heat load.

A powerful gaming PC, for example, can pump out a surprising amount of heat. Factor that into your BTU calculation, especially if you're a hardcore gamer in a small room.

Ceiling Height: It's Not Just for Basketball Players

Rooms with high ceilings need more BTUs. Remember, you're cooling the volume of the room, not just the square footage.

If your ceilings are over 8 feet tall, you might want to consult a professional or use a more detailed BTU calculator online. It's like trying to fill a giant inflatable pool with a garden hose; you need more power.

Finding the BTU on Your Existing Air Conditioner

If you already have an air conditioner and just want to know its BTU rating, it's usually printed right on the unit. Look for a sticker or label on the side or back.

The BTU rating is often listed as part of the model number. Sometimes, it's abbreviated as "BTU/h" or simply "BTU."

If you can't find the BTU rating on the unit itself, try searching for the model number online. The manufacturer's website or online retailers usually list the specifications.

Beyond BTUs: Efficiency Matters Too!

While BTU rating is important, don't forget to consider the energy efficiency of the air conditioner. Look for the Energy Star label, which indicates that the unit meets certain energy efficiency standards.

Energy-efficient air conditioners can save you money on your electricity bill over the long run. It's like getting a free scoop of ice cream with every purchase; a sweet deal for your wallet.

The SEER (Seasonal Energy Efficiency Ratio) rating is another important indicator of energy efficiency. The higher the SEER rating, the more efficient the air conditioner.

Maintenance: Keeping Your Cool Customer Cool

Regular maintenance is essential for keeping your air conditioner running efficiently. Clean the air filters regularly to ensure proper airflow.

Dirty air filters can restrict airflow, forcing your AC to work harder and consume more energy. It's like trying to breathe through a clogged straw; not fun for anyone involved.

Schedule regular maintenance checks with a qualified HVAC technician to ensure that your AC is in good working order. They can identify and fix potential problems before they become major issues.
